Output 5374691387b7bccdd19bfb0f51e13bcdf809ffec117637c7ce65d890ebc00a26:18

value
3141262
script pubkey
OP_0 OP_PUSHBYTES_20 684a6d26c9fd5c1c6c1e6c0e7bbe6f57552aed1b
address
bc1qdp9x6fkfl4wpcmq7ds88h0n02a2j4mgmd54m0t
transaction
5374691387b7bccdd19bfb0f51e13bcdf809ffec117637c7ce65d890ebc00a26
confirmations
2908
spent
true